I picked up 'Superintelligence: Paths, Dangers, Strategies' after hearing so much buzz about it in tech circles, and wow, it really makes you think. Nick Bostrom dives deep into what happens when machines surpass human intelligence, and it's not just sci-fi fluff—he lays out logical scenarios that feel chillingly plausible. The first half had me hooked with its exploration of how AI could evolve, but the later sections on control problems dragged a bit for me. Still, the book's core idea lingers: if we don't prepare for superintelligence now, we might regret it later. It's like a chess match where we're barely learning the rules while the opponent's already ten moves ahead.

What surprised me was how accessible it felt despite the heavy subject. Bostrom avoids drowning readers in jargon, though some chapters require slow reading to digest. I found myself debating his 'instrumental convergence' theory with friends for weeks—that moment when you realize all advanced AIs might inherently want the same dangerous things, like self-preservation, was a real forehead-slapper. Perfect for anyone who enjoyed 'Life 3.0' but craved more technical meat. Just don't expect bedtime reading—this one keeps you up staring at the ceiling.

Bostrom's 'Superintelligence' is like a fire alarm for humanity—loud, urgent, and impossible to ignore once you hear it. I blew through the first third in one sitting because his writing has this slow-burn tension, like watching a disaster unfold in slow motion. His famous 'paperclip maximizer' thought experiment alone justifies the read—a simple AI designed to make paperclips could theoretically turn the entire universe into paperclip materials if unchecked. That absurd-yet-logical premise captures the book's strength: making abstract risks feel concrete.

The middle section lost me temporarily with its deep dives into reward function modeling, but the final chapters redeemed it with practical governance discussions. It's not perfect (I wanted more on near-term AI risks), but it fundamentally changed how I view technology's trajectory. Reading Bostrom's book felt like attending a masterclass where the professor keeps dropping existential bombshells casually. The way he breaks down potential AI development paths—from slow takeoff to explosive singularity—is methodical yet terrifying. I kept bookmarking pages about 'orthogonality thesis' (turns out, super-smart AI doesn't necessarily share human values) and his 'vulnerable world' concept. What sticks with me months later is how he frames superintelligence as an engineering challenge rather than magic—it's about imperfect humans trying to build something that could outthink us all.

That said, parts read like a dense academic paper, especially the strategies section. I wish there were more narrative hooks or case studies to balance the theoretical weight. But when he describes scenarios like an AI hiding its true capabilities until it's too late? Chills. It's the kind of book that makes you side-eye your smart speaker differently. If you're into philosophy or tech ethics, it's essential—but maybe pair it with something lighter as a mental palate cleanser.

What Strategies Are Used For Each Position In Quidditch?

4 Answers2025-09-18 06:13:42
Quidditch is such a thrilling sport, isn’t it? Each position has its own dynamic strategies that make the game not just about speed, but also tactics and teamwork. Starting with the Chasers, their primary role is to score points by throwing the 'quaffle' through the opponent's hoops. They often employ strategies like weaving in and out of defenders, using feints to confuse the opposing Beaters, and passing intricately among themselves. Communication is key here; Chasers must anticipate one another’s movements to make quick plays that can catch the opposite team's defense off-guard. Now let’s talk about the Beaters. These players have the fun job of protecting their team while being aggressive with the Bludgers. Effective beaters use a strategy of ‘clearing the way’ for their Chasers by disrupting the opposing players, not just the Bludgers! High levels of coordination with one another are crucial. If one Beater sends a Bludger towards the opposing Chasers, the other should be quick to cover for their teammates by focusing on the defensive aspects to keep them safe. Then, of course, you have the Keepers, who serve as the last line of defense. This position relies heavily on observation. They must read the attackers' movements and be ready to react. It’s all about positioning and anticipation; the Keeper needs to be agile, predicting the angle of the 'quaffle' and blocking it effectively. A seasoned Keeper can even work hand-in-hand with the Chasers to launch counter-attacks, surprising the opponents! And let's not forget the Seeker, often seen as the star of the show with their key role in capturing the Golden Snitch. The strategy here isn't just a race to grab the Snitch first. It involves a lot of patience and strategic positioning to capitalize on any mistakes the opposing Seeker makes. Sometimes it’s all about using deception to throw off your opponent, while keeping a sharp awareness of the game dynamics. What a blend of skills this sport demands! What Marketing Strategies Target The Difference Between Fiction And Non Fiction?

1 Answers2025-07-18 14:28:47
Marketing fiction and nonfiction requires distinct approaches because they cater to different reader motivations. Fiction thrives on emotional engagement and escapism, so marketing often focuses on storytelling elements—vivid worlds, compelling characters, and immersive plots. For example, promoting a fantasy novel like 'The Name of the Wind' might highlight its intricate magic system or the protagonist’s journey, leveraging fan art, quote graphics, and thematic playlists to build hype. Nonfiction, however, appeals to practicality and curiosity. A book like 'Atomic Habits' markets its actionable insights, using testimonials, data snippets, and author credibility (like TED Talks) to emphasize utility. Platforms like Instagram Reels or TikTok are gold for fiction’s visual appeal, while LinkedIn or podcasts better suit nonfiction’s expert-driven content. Another key difference is audience targeting. Fiction readers often seek communities—think subreddits dissecting 'A Court of Thorns and Roses' or Discord servers roleplaying 'Dungeons & Dragons' tie-ins. Publishers leverage this by organizing virtual events (e.g., live Q&As with authors) or interactive campaigns (e.g., 'choose-your-ending' Twitter polls). Nonfiction audiences prioritize problem-solving; marketing might involve webinars, free downloadable templates, or collaborations with industry influencers. For instance, a memoir about resilience could partner with mental health advocates, while a historical analysis might tap into academic circles. The tone matters too: fiction copy is lush and evocative ('Step into a world where shadows whisper secrets'), while nonfiction is direct ('Transform your productivity in 30 days'). Timing also plays a role. Fiction benefits from sustained pre-release buzz—serialized excerpts, behind-the-scenes worldbuilding blogs, or ARG (alternate reality game) elements. Nonfiction often ties into current events or trends; a book on crypto would rush to market during a Bitcoin surge. Pricing strategies differ too: fiction leans on limited-edition covers or signed copies to drive collector interest, whereas nonfiction offers bulk discounts for corporate or educational sales. Both genres use email lists, but fiction newsletters might tease lore snippets, while nonfiction provides study guides or cheat sheets. Ultimately, the divide mirrors the reader’s intent—one seeks wonder, the other wisdom—and savvy marketing bridges that gap with tailored authenticity.

What Books On TCP/IP Cover Practical Implementation Strategies?

2 Answers2025-11-19 08:06:50
Exploring books on TCP/IP can be pretty fascinating since they blend theory and practical application seamlessly. One gem I often recommend is 'TCP/IP Illustrated, Volume 1' by W. Richard Stevens. This book isn't just about protocols; it dives deep into the practical aspects of how these protocols work in real-world scenarios. Stevens has a knack for breaking down complex concepts into digestible information, pairing it with code examples and illustrations that really stick. The first part focuses on the fundamentals of TCP and IP, laying a solid groundwork for readers. It's not overly technical, which is a blessing for those who might feel overwhelmed by dry textbooks. The real-world examples and packet traces are especially helpful when trying to visualize how data travels across a network. Whether you're setting up a local network or diving into heavy-duty enterprise solutions, this book’s insights can prove invaluable. Another title to consider is 'Network Warrior' by Gary A. Donahue. It’s less of a textbook and more of a companion for those who want to get their hands dirty. Donahue presents a very pragmatic approach, covering a variety of scenarios that network professionals face daily. There's a blend of theory and practical tasks that keeps readers engaged and allows them to apply what they learn directly to their jobs. The author’s conversational tone makes complex topics feel like an easy chat with a colleague, which I’ve found super helpful when trying to grasp intricate details. Moreover, the tips and tricks provided are like little nuggets of wisdom gathered from years of experience in the field. In summary, both these books provide a combination of deep dives into TCP/IP concepts and practical implementation strategies that cater to learners of all levels, ensuring that you finish the reads not just informed but also enriched with practical skills to apply right away.

Can Zerg Strategies Work In Other Video Games?

3 Answers2025-09-19 15:49:13
The concept of Zerg strategies, which often emphasizes overwhelming the enemy with sheer numbers and rapid expansion, can definitely find its way into other games! I’m a huge fan of real-time strategy games, and thinking about how Zerg tactics can apply outside 'StarCraft' is both fascinating and practical. For instance, in games like 'Age of Empires', this approach works surprisingly well. Speed and numbers can overwhelm opponents who are trying to get their economies and defenses set up. Early-game rushes, where you flood the battlefield with low-cost units, often catch opponents off guard—it's all about initiative! In team-based multiplayer games like 'League of Legends', a Zerg mindset can manifest as aggressive map control. Gathering a bunch of champions and coordinating an attack on an enemy turret can replicate that overwhelming feeling, much like swarming in 'StarCraft'. It’s all about the mind game; if you can pressure your opponents quickly, they might crumble under the weight of constant attacks. Timing and unpredictability play vital roles here. However, not every game is suited for this strategy. In turn-based games such as 'XCOM', brute force is not as effective. Positioning, stealth, and strategic attacks matter far more than throwing bodies at problems. Overall, I’d say looking at other gaming genres through a Zerg lens can offer refreshing gameplay, as long as you adjust your tactics to fit the game mechanics!
